Cinnamon Price in Vietnam (FOB) - 2022

The average cinnamon export price stood at $5,308 per ton in December 2022, surging by 1.9% against the previous month. In general, the export price recorded a relatively flat trend pattern.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in January 2022 when the average export price increased by 7.8% month-to-month. As a result, the export price reached the peak level of $5,573 per ton. From February 2022 to December 2022, the the average export prices failed to regain momentum.

Prices varied noticeably by the country of destination: the country with the highest price was Indonesia ($7,513 per ton), while the average price for exports to Bangladesh ($3,774 per ton) was amongst the lowest.

From December 2021 to December 2022, the most notable rate of growth in terms of prices was recorded for supplies to the Netherlands (+1.5%), while the prices for the other major destinations experienced more modest paces of growth.

Cinnamon Price in Vietnam (CIF) - 2022

In 2022, the average cinnamon import price amounted to $6,227 per ton, reducing by -3.4% against the previous year. Over the period under review, the import price, however, continues to indicate a remarkable increase. The pace of growth appeared the most rapid in 2017 an increase of 50% against the previous year. Over the period under review, average import prices reached the peak figure at $6,447 per ton in 2021, and then fell in the following year.

Average prices varied noticeably amongst the major supplying countries. In 2022, amid the top importers, the country with the highest price was China ($6,253 per ton), while the price for Indonesia totaled $6,081 per ton.

From 2012 to 2022, the most notable rate of growth in terms of prices was attained by Indonesia (+15.3%).

Cinnamon Exports in Vietnam

In 2022, shipments abroad of cinnamon (canella) decreased by -6.5% to 49K tons for the first time since 2018, thus ending a three-year rising trend. In general, exports, however, saw significant growth. The pace of growth appeared the most rapid in 2021 with an increase of 59% against the previous year. As a result, the exports reached the peak of 53K tons, and then dropped in the following year.

In value terms, cinnamon exports dropped slightly to $260M in 2022. Overall, total exports indicated a prominent increase from 2019 to 2022: its value increased at an average annual rate of +14.7% over the last three years. The trend pattern, however, indicated some noticeable fluctuations being recorded throughout the analyzed period. Based on 2022 figures, exports increased by +50.7% against 2019 indices.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2020 when exports increased by 38% against the previous year.

Top Export Markets for Cinnamon from Vietnam in 2022:

  1. India (21.3K tons)
  2. United States (7.5K tons)
  3. Bangladesh (2.9K tons)
  4. Netherlands (1.4K tons)
  5. Brazil (1.1K tons)
  6. Indonesia (1.1K tons)
  7. South Korea (1.1K tons)
  8. Germany (0.9K tons)
  9. Algeria (0.8K tons)
  10. United Arab Emirates (0.8K tons)
  11. Dominican Republic (0.8K tons)
  12. Malaysia (0.7K tons)

Cinnamon Imports in Vietnam

After three years of growth, overseas purchases of cinnamon (canella) decreased by -4.2% to 8.5K tons in 2022. In general, imports, however, showed a significant expansion. The growth pace was the most rapid in 2021 when imports increased by 78%. As a result, imports attained the peak of 8.9K tons, and then shrank in the following year.

In value terms, cinnamon imports declined to $53M in 2022. Overall, imports, however, enjoyed a significant increase. The growth pace was the most rapid in 2021 with an increase of 94% against the previous year. As a result, imports reached the peak of $58M, and then reduced in the following year.

Top Suppliers of Cinnamon to Vietnam in 2022:

  1. China (7.2K tons)
  2. Indonesia (1.3K tons)
